智能车制作

 找回密码
 注册

扫一扫,访问微社区

查看: 1090|回复: 2
打印 上一主题 下一主题

野火的库函数,FTM问题,求大神、火哥指教。。。。。

[复制链接]

61

主题

545

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
3810

优秀会员奖章活跃会员奖章论坛骨干奖章在线王奖章论坛元老奖章

威望
1747
贡献
995
兑换币
1052
注册时间
2013-9-7
在线时间
534 小时
跳转到指定楼层
1#
发表于 2014-1-23 10:45:25 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我想通过调占空比来调节电机的转速,就使用了FTM_PWM_Duty(FTM0, CH0, a)这个函数,当a值比较小(小于800)的时候(占空比精度设为0.01%),程序运行没问题。a值一旦变大,程序就莫名的跑到delay函数去了,电机就不动了。

精度设为0.01%,占空比最大值应该是10000才对,为什么这个值变大,程序就不行了。。。。。。。。。。

求大神解释一下。。。。。。。
回复

使用道具 举报

38

主题

276

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
3032
威望
1999
贡献
135
兑换币
1253
注册时间
2013-1-25
在线时间
449 小时
2#
发表于 2014-1-23 12:22:59 | 只看该作者
有没有可能a的数值超过了数据类型的最大值溢出了。
回复 支持 反对

使用道具 举报

61

主题

545

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
3810

优秀会员奖章活跃会员奖章论坛骨干奖章在线王奖章论坛元老奖章

威望
1747
贡献
995
兑换币
1052
注册时间
2013-9-7
在线时间
534 小时
3#
 楼主| 发表于 2014-1-23 15:11:13 | 只看该作者
2601819196 发表于 2014-1-23 12:22
有没有可能a的数值超过了数据类型的最大值溢出了。

用的k60,定义的类型都是u32的,应该不会超范围的吧。。。。。。。。。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关于我们|联系我们|小黑屋|智能车制作 ( 黑ICP备2022002344号

GMT+8, 2024-9-20 22:44 , Processed in 0.147196 second(s), 26 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表